Italian Focaccia bread is a flat oven bread, and my recipe makes it a healthy Focaccia bread. This bread is something similar to a Pizza but a little thicker. I am always health conscious and try to keep my bread as healthy as possible. My usual me asked me to make healthy Focaccia bread by replacing 50% of the all-purpose flour with whole wheat flour.

Ingredients
 

  • 125 gm Whole Wheat Flour
  • 125 gm All Purpose Flour
  • 10 gm Yeast fresh
  • 1 tsp Sugar
  • 1 tsp Salt or as per taste
  • 1 tsp Garlic Powder
  • 150 ml Water
  • 3 tbsp Olive Oil
  • 1/2 cup Onions caramelized
  • 1/4 cup Black Olives pitted

Instructions
 

  • In a bowl, take 50 ml lukewarm water. Add sugar and yeast to it. Mix it well and keep aside for 10 minutes or until yeast froths.

  • In a mixing bowl, take wheat flour, All-purpose flour, salt, garlic powder, Olive oil. Make a well in the centre and add yeast solution. Start kneading. Add water little by little and make a dough.
  • Initially the dough will be sticky. Keep kneading the dough for 10 minutes. You will get a smooth, elastic and non-sticky dough.
  • Grease a pan and place kneaded dough into it. Cover it with cling wrap and let it rest for 40 minutes for the first rise or until it doubles in volume.

  • After first rise, Take out the dough on a surface, lightly dusted with flour and punch the dough to release the air. Knead the dough for another 5 minutes.
  • With the help of a rolling pin, roll the dough out into a sheet of 1 inch thickness. Place this in a greased baking tin. Add caramelized onions and Black olives evenly on it.
  • Cover it with cling wrap and set aside for another 30 minutes for second rise or until doubles in volumes.
  • After second rise, bake the bread in a preheated oven at 200 degree Celsius for 25 minutes. Once done, infuse it with some olive oil and serve.
